2.5ins, 6ins and 6.5ins respectively.

The perimeter of a 5-12-13 triangle would be 30 in.
The shortest side is 5/30 = 1/6 of the perimeter, the middle side is 12/30 = 2/5 and the biggest is 13/30.
So, for the triangle with perimeter 15 inches, the smallest side is 1/6*15 = 2.5 inches.
The middle side is 2/5*15 = 6 inches and the biggest side is 13/30*15 = 6.5 inches.

What is the ratio of the length of a side of an equilateral triangle to its perimeter?

Length of a side of an equilateral triangle : Perimeter = 1 : 3 For example, if the length of the sides of an equilateral triangle were 5cm each, then perimeter would be three times that much - 15cm. 5 : 15 is the same as 1 : 3 when simplified. How do you find the perimeter of a triangle if you only know the length of two sides?

You cannot discover the perimeter of a triangle if all you have is the length of two sides and nothing else. Knowing only the length of two sides of a triangle is insufficient to discover the length of the third side, and, thereby, discover the perimeter. How do you find the unknown length of one side of a triangle when you know the perimeter and the length of the other two sides?

subtract the two sides that you know from the perimeter to get the unknown side.


What is the perimeter of an equilateral triangle with one side 10.5?

An equilateral triangle has all three sides the same length. → perimeter = 3 × 10.5 = 31.5 units.
